The Versatile Uses and Applications of Methyl Diethanolamine


Methyl diethanolamine (MDEA) is an organic compound that has gained attention for its diverse applications across various industries. As a colorless liquid with a distinctive ammonia-like odor, MDEA serves as a multifunctional intermediate in the synthesis of numerous formulations. Its chemical structure, featuring both amine and hydroxyl groups, endows it with the ability to interact with a range of substances, making it an essential ingredient in multiple applications.


1. Chemical Industry


One of the primary uses of MDEA is in the chemical industry, where it acts as a solvent and chemical intermediate. It is commonly utilized in the production of agrochemicals, detergents, and surfactants. In the manufacturing of herbicides and pesticides, MDEA enhances the solubility of active ingredients, thereby improving their effectiveness. Additionally, its surfactant properties make it valuable in producing personal care products, including shampoos and conditioners.


2. Gas Treatment


MDEA is particularly renowned for its role in natural gas processing. It is primarily used as an amine solvent in acid gas removal processes, specifically in the removal of hydrogen sulfide (H2S) and carbon dioxide (CO2) from natural gas streams. The advantages of using MDEA in gas treatment processes include its low volatility, minimal degradation, and high absorption capacity. These properties allow for efficient gas purification, resulting in higher-quality gas that meets industry standards.


3. Oil and Gas Industry


Beyond natural gas processing, MDEA is also employed in the oil and gas sector for enhanced oil recovery (EOR). It increases the mobility of crude oil by reducing its viscosity. In this regard, MDEA serves as a vital reagent that supports the extraction of oil from reservoirs that may be difficult to access. The chemical’s amphiphilic nature allows it to interact with both water and oil, facilitating the process of oil extraction while minimizing environmental impact.

4. Pharmaceutical Applications


MDEA has found applications in the pharmaceutical industry, particularly as a building block for the synthesis of various drug formulations. Its ability to form stable salts with different acids makes it a suitable candidate for developing active pharmaceutical ingredients (APIs). Furthermore, MDEA's role as a pH modifier can enhance the solubility of certain drugs, improving their bioavailability in the body.


5. Textiles and Dyes


In the textile industry, MDEA functions as a dye-fixing agent and a softening agent. It aids in the fixation of dyes onto fabrics, ensuring vibrant colors that are resistant to washing and fading. Additionally, its use as a softener enhances the texture and feel of textiles, making garments more comfortable to wear.


6. Cosmetics and Personal Care Products


MDEA is widely used in the formulation of cosmetics and personal care products. Its emulsifying properties help to blend water and oil-based ingredients, contributing to a smooth and consistent texture in lotions, creams, and other topical products. Moreover, MDEA's moisture-retaining characteristics enhance skin hydration and overall appearance, making it a sought-after ingredient in beauty formulations.
